The President JKFGA S. Tajinder Singh said the exploring penitential of international market is a good step for the promotion of commercial floriculture in J&K state, But we should not forget the real fact that India itself is a market of 1200 corers of fresh flowers annually and our state has a potential for flower market not less that 50 croces. International companies recommended our state as a best place for growing any type of flower bulbs and producing aromatic oils in which we have a monopoly over rest of the India.
But before talking about exports we neec to raise our standard to the international levels.
He appealed to the Chief Minister Omar Abdullah on behalf of flower growers Of the state to direct Chief Sectary Of the State S. S. Kapoor to provide necessary Insfrasture like International lavel practical on hand training centre for flower growers, capcity bulding and training ,portable and central cold storages for making cold chain,soil and water testing centres in C.S.S. Rastriya Krishi Vikas Yojna for the development of flower industry in the state.
He further Apealed to govt that one time commercial floriculture policy to be framed with the involvement of experienced technocrates and stake holders to insure the fruitful results from these polices.
